Grass Pollen Has Peaked, Now What?

If the last few weeks of July have felt relentless, itchy eyes, foggy thinking, a nose that won't quit, you're not imagining it. Grass pollen has likely hit its peak, and mid-season your immune system responds differently than it did in April. Medication that worked early on may need reinforcing now. Here's how to reassess your plan before the season lets up.

Allergies, Asthma, or Anxiety: How to Tell the Difference?

You wake up with a tight chest. Your heart is racing. You can't quite catch your breath. Is it allergies? Asthma? Or anxiety mimicking something physical? These three conditions share a surprising number of symptoms and can exist in the same person at the same time, making each other worse. Here's how to tell them apart, and why getting the right answer matters.
